Andrea de Cesaris (1959 - 2014)

A sad day for motorsport gets a little sadder with the news that former F1 driver Andrea de Cesaris has died in a motorbike accident.The Roman-born racer held the unfortunate record of being the driver to participate in the most Grand Prix (208) without ever winning a race, while his record in terms of incidents was to earn him the soubriquet, Andrea de Crasheris.A kart champion in Italy, he subsequently moved to Britain to participate in F3, finishing runner-up in the 1979 championship.
